Start Acquire: Begin processing and displaying data.
A. If you selected Store on Disk above, and selected Prompt for
Header Information in the Header Form setup (Configure menu),
the Header Information dialog box appears. Fill in the desired
header and click OK.
B. A message similar to one of the following will appear
(message dependent on the instrument and if CTD is connected
to a water sampler):
For an instrument that is started by movement of a magnetic
switch (such as SBE 19, 19plus, or 25) -
SEASAVE allows 60 seconds after you click Start Acquire for
you to turn on the CTD magnetic switch. SEASAVE will time
out if data is not received from the instrument within this time.
The time can be increased if needed (see Appendix I: Command
Line Operation).
For other instruments (such as an SBE 16, 16plus, 21, 45, 49, or
911plus) -
SEASAVE will time out if data is not received from the
instrument within 60 seconds.
Save and Exit: Save the real-time data setup (.con and data file
names, number of scans to average, and COMM port configuration).
If saved, the next time you select Start Acquisition in the
RealtimeData menu, the dialog box will appear with your
saved selections.
3. To stop data acquisition: In the RealtimeData menu, select
Stop Acquisition.
